What I'm looking for
I am a bilingual law clerk with hands-on experience in estate planning, probate, family law, and business formation, delivering clear legal documents and client communication in both English and Spanish.
I have drafted trusts, powers of attorney, corporate formation documents, and mediated disputes while supporting attorneys in research, court appearances, and remote client consultations.
I thrive in client-facing roles, create user-friendly legal guides, and pursue continued growth through certifications such as Notary Public and Loan Signing Agent.
